Sack Underperforming Ministers, Service Chiefs – Northern Forum Tells Tinubu
An amalgamation of leaders from nineteen northern states in Nigeria has urged President Bola Ahmed Tinubu to urgently sack underperforming ministers and security chiefs.
The convener of the Northern Ethnic National Forum, NENF, Dominic Alancha, disclosed this in a statement on Sunday.
He said Tinubu should reshuffle his cabinet and security architecture because the nation faces a “multi-dimensional crisis” that requires decisive action.
According to the coalition, the current pace of governance is insufficient to address the challenges confronting Nigerians, particularly in the northern part of the country.
The forum said, “Many current ministers have demonstrated a great inability to translate policy into tangible results, connect with the grassroots, or build the political goodwill necessary to solidify the administration’s standing.”
“Immediately initiate a comprehensive dissolution and reshuffle of the Federal Executive Council.”
It added, “Daily, our communities are ravaged. Farmers are unable to access their fields, and our highways have become death traps,” explaining why the president should relieve the underperforming security chiefs.
